Best Schools in Holliday, MO
Holliday, MO has a total of 9 schools including 3 high schools, 3 middle schools and 3 elementary schools. A total of 1,390 students attend Holliday, MO schools. On average, schools in Holliday score 31%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 34%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Holliday don't me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Holliday, MO
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Holliday, MO has a total population of 446 with 15%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 88%, and 14%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
